    Understanding Disruptive Technologies

    Disruptive technologies are those innovations that shake up existing markets and industries. They often introduce a new value proposition, making older technologies or ways of doing things obsolete. Think about how smartphones disrupted the mobile phone industry or how streaming services changed the way we consume media. These technologies aren't just about making things better; they fundamentally alter the landscape.

    What Makes a Technology Disruptive?

    1. Innovation: At the heart of every disruptive technology is a novel idea or approach. This could be a new way of solving an old problem or addressing a need that people didn't even know they had.
    2. Market Transformation: Disruptive technologies create new markets and value networks. They can displace established market leaders and reshape industry dynamics.
    3. Accessibility and Affordability: Often, these technologies become more accessible and affordable over time, allowing a broader range of people to benefit from them.
    4. Improved Performance: While initial versions might not always be superior to existing solutions, disruptive technologies tend to improve rapidly, eventually outperforming traditional options.

    3. Revolutionary Technologies

    Revolutionary technologies cause a complete and fundamental change in the way things are done. This term underscores the radical nature of these innovations and their potential to disrupt entire industries. Revolutionary technologies are not just incremental improvements; they represent a paradigm shift that alters the status quo and creates new possibilities. The development of the internet, for example, was a revolutionary technology that transformed communication, commerce, and information sharing on a global scale. It has connected billions of people and enabled the creation of new industries and business models. In the field of medicine, the discovery of antibiotics was a revolutionary breakthrough that saved countless lives and transformed the treatment of infectious diseases. Similarly, the invention of the printing press was a revolutionary technology that democratized access to knowledge and facilitated the spread of ideas. As revolutionary technologies continue to emerge, they have the potential to address some of the world's most pressing challenges and improve the quality of life for people around the globe. These technologies often face resistance from established interests but ultimately pave the way for a better future.

    Challenges of Disruptive Technologies

    • Job Displacement: Disruptive technologies can automate tasks and displace workers, leading to job losses and economic disruption.
    • Ethical Concerns: Disruptive technologies raise ethical concerns related to privacy, security, and bias, requiring careful consideration and regulation.
    • Market Disruption: Disruptive technologies can disrupt existing markets and business models, creating uncertainty and challenges for established companies.
    • Regulatory Hurdles: Disruptive technologies often face regulatory hurdles and legal challenges, requiring companies to navigate complex legal frameworks.
    • Resistance to Change: Disruptive technologies can encounter resistance from individuals and organizations that are invested in the status quo.
